Stone masonry installation services involve the skilled placement and assembly of natural or manufactured stone materials to create durable and aesthetically appealing structures. These services typically include laying stone for walls, facades, fireplaces, and decorative features, ensuring proper alignment, stability, and craftsmanship. Professionals may also prepare the foundation and apply finishing touches to achieve a seamless and long-lasting result. The process emphasizes precision and attention to detail to preserve the structural integrity and visual appeal of each project.

These services help address various problems related to property durability and appearance. Stone masonry can reinforce weak or damaged structures, prevent water infiltration, and improve the overall stability of walls and foundations. Additionally, stone features can serve as low-maintenance, weather-resistant solutions that withstand the elements over time. Proper installation by experienced pros also helps avoid issues such as cracking, shifting, or deterioration, which can lead to costly repairs if not addressed early.

Material Costs - The cost of stone materials for masonry installation typically ranges from $10 to $50 per square foot, depending on the type of stone chosen. For example, natural stone may cost around $30 per square foot, while manufactured options could be closer to $15. Material prices can vary based on quality and source.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for stone masonry installation generally fall between $40 and $80 per hour, with total project costs influenced by complexity and scope. For a standard wall, labor might total $1,000 to $3,000, depending on size and detail.

Project Size and Scope - Larger or more intricate projects tend to increase overall costs, with small residential installations averaging around $2,000 to $5,000. Larger commercial or extensive landscaping projects can exceed $10,000, depending on design and materials used.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include site preparation, foundation work, or finishing touches,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the total. For example, foundation excavation might range from $500 to $2,000 extra, depending on site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one are used in masonry installation? Common materials include granite, limestone, sandstone, and marble, depending on the project requirements and aesthetic preferences.

How long does stone masonry installation typically take? The duration varies based on the scope and complexity of the project, with local pros providing timelines during consultations.

Is stone masonry suitable for outdoor structures? Yes, stone masonry is often used for outdoor features such as walls, patios, and fireplaces due to its durability and weather resistance.

What maintenance is required for stone masonry? Maintenance generally includes regular cleaning and inspecting for any damage, with repairs handled by local specialists as needed.
